On episode 5 of the Late Night History podcast Aaron Love joins the show to discuss the history of US Air Force Pararescue Jumpers or PJs. Outside of the US military, the general public largely believes the Air Force consists of just pilots, but Aaron and I discuss how the PJs have been instrumental in every military operation since the Vietnam War. Some highlights include how PJs deploy to combat zones, as humanitarian relief, and even in support of NASA; more fascinating food escapades while working with partner units overseas; the history of their beloved mascot "Charlie The PJ"; and much, much more!
